Hostess Recalling 710,000 Boxes Of Ding Dong, Zinger, Other Snacks Over Possible Peanut Residue

LOS ANGELES (CBSLA.com) — Hostess Brands has announced the voluntary recall of more than 700,000 boxes of cakes and donuts.

The snack food company says the treats may include contain peanut residue though peanuts aren't listed as an ingredient.

The recall affects Ding Dong, Zinger, Chocodiles, and donuts and includes single serve (snack cakes and donuts), multipack boxes, and bagged donuts.

The products were sold to merchandisers, grocery stores, distributors, dollar stores, drug stores, and convenience stores across the nation and Mexico.
